What Is Venetian Plaster?

Venetian plaster is a decorative wall finish traditionally made from slaked lime and marble dust. When applied in thin, layered coats and burnished, it creates a surface that mimics natural stone, rich with depth, variation, and luminosity.

Unlike standard paint, Venetian plaster:

  • Builds dimension through layers, not just color
  • Reflects light in a soft, natural way
  • Creates a stone-like, breathable finish
  • Evolves visually throughout the day as lighting changes

This centuries-old technique originated in Italy and became especially popular in Venice, where breathable, moisture-resistant finishes were essential in humid, canal-side buildings.

Texture vs. Color: Why Venetian Plaster Is Different from Paint

With paint, color does most of the work. With Venetian plaster, texture is just as important as color, if not more.

The way plaster is applied, trowel strokes, layering, and burnishing creates movement that:

  • Shifts throughout the day with changing light
  • Adds dimension even in neutral tones
  • Creates a dynamic, ever-evolving surface

Morning light may reveal soft tonal variation, while evening lighting highlights depth and sheen. This is something flat paint simply cannot achieve.

Why You Should Hire a Professional Venetian Plaster Applicator

While Venetian plaster is stunning, it is also a high-skill, artisan finish.

This is not a standard paint job. The final result depends heavily on:

  • Trowel technique
  • Layering process
  • Timing and pressure during burnishing
  • Understanding of material behavior

A professional applicator ensures:

  • Consistent, high-end results
  • Proper surface preparation
  • Long-lasting durability
  • The exact aesthetic you’re envisioning

In short, Venetian plaster is as much about craftsmanship as it is about the product itself.

Top 5 FAQs About Venetian Plaster

Q: Is Venetian plaster better than paint?
A: Venetian plaster offers depth, texture, and a luxury finish that paint cannot achieve. While paint is quicker and more affordable, plaster delivers a more custom, high-end result.

Q: How long does Venetian plaster last?
A: When applied correctly, Venetian plaster can last for decades. Its mineral-based composition makes it highly durable and resistant to wear.

Q: Is Venetian plaster waterproof?
A: Traditional lime-based plasters are breathable and moisture-resistant but not fully waterproof unless sealed. They perform well in humid environments when properly finished. For showers, use a water-resistant microcement plaster like Meoded Concretta.

Q: Can Venetian plaster be applied over drywall?
A: Yes, it can be applied over properly prepared, painted drywall over Meoded Quartz Primer.

Q: Is Venetian plaster expensive?
A: Venetian plaster is typically more expensive than paint due to materials and skilled labor, but the result is a long-lasting, luxury finish that adds significant design value.
